Sabbath Riffs are the riffs that count most. Each member of the band's original line-up brought something new to rock & roll. Tony Iommi showed the world that the guitar riff could carry a whole song. Geezer Butler took the bass guitar approach of Cream to the next logical step, obviating the need for the band to ever have a rhythm guitarist. Bill Ward forgot that the drummer in a heavy rock band was supposed to play straight beats and stick to a timekeeping role. Ozzy Ozbourne was, well, slightly mental, to say the least.
